John Josiah "Yankee John" Church 1736–1810 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 27 October 1736

Birth Location: Connecticut, Connecticut, USA

Death Date: 1 Apr 1810

Death Location: Purlear, Wilkes County, North Carolina, United States of America

Father: John Church*-Curtis

Mother: Anna Curtis*-Church

Spouse(s): Mildred Church, Jane Andrews

Children(s): Elijah Sr, Elisha Church

In 1736, John Josiah "Yankee John" Church entered the world in Connecticut, Connecticut, USA, born to John Church Curtis And Anna Curtis Church. John Josiah "Yankee John" Church married Harriet H Church, Jane Nancy Andrews, Mildred Elizabeth Church, and had children including Elijah Sr Old Lije Church Sr, Elisha Church. John Josiah "Yankee John" Church passed away in 1810 in Purlear, Wilkes County, North Carolina, United States of America.
